Diving at the Commonwealth Games

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Diving is one of the sports at the quadrennialCommonwealth Games competition. It has been aCommonwealth Games sport since the inaugural edition of the event's precursor, the1930 British Empire Games. It is an optional sport and may or may not be included in the sporting programme of each edition of the games.
